if youre too lowlevel when attempting to enter a new act the game will give you and additional warning aside from saying youre leaving to act 2
The 2nd map is a new zone, the 3rd map is also a new zone, both are sizable but act 2 feels shorter since it's more condensed compared to act 1. People may be confused cause leaving the first map is technically part of act 2, but you won't actually get there until you enter the proper map. The shadowlands
I completed the starting zone about level 5. I then went in and did the underdark and reached level 6. Then went to do the Githyanki zone and reached level 7. I am now Level 7 in the shadowlands and doing well.

I think level 6 would be fine in shadowlands, I think level 5 would be a bit difficult, though doable. Definitely not level 4.
I suspect Act 2 should be started at level 5, and ended at about level 8. I ended Act 2 at nearly level 9 (hit level 9 within minutes of entering Act 3), but I also did the majority of the content (not 100%, but I explored probably 90% and only skipped a couple of minor side-quests). You might be as high as nearly level 10 instead by Act 3 if you truly did everything, but that's a stretch for most players.

Difficulty-wise, you'll want to be at least level 5 in the Shadowlands when you get there - level 4 would be rough (though possible if you are careful). That's just for the opening section of the Shadowlands too, the second "half" (most of the content) you definitely should be above level 6 for.
